Rajasthan, a state in India, is known for its rich culture and history. The women of Rajasthan are often celebrated for their beauty. This beauty is not just about physical appearance but also about grace, elegance, and strength.

Rajasthan's women have a unique charm. They wear traditional attire, which includes colorful sarees and lehengas. These clothes are often adorned with intricate embroidery and mirror work. They also wear jewelry made of gold, silver, and precious stones. This traditional attire enhances their natural beauty.

Their beauty also comes from their lifestyle. Many women in Rajasthan live in rural areas. They work hard, often helping with farming and household chores. This hard work gives them a natural strength and resilience. Their skin is often sun-kissed from working outside, adding to their unique look.

Rajasthan's women also have a sense of grace and poise. They carry themselves with dignity, no matter their circumstances. This inner strength and confidence make them even more beautiful.

Their beauty is also reflected in their art and culture. Many women in Rajasthan are skilled in traditional crafts. They create beautiful textiles, pottery, and jewelry. These skills are passed down through generations, adding to their cultural richness.

Music and dance are also a big part of their lives. Traditional Rajasthani dances like Ghoomar and Kalbeliya are performed by women. These dances are graceful and require skill and practice. Watching a Rajasthani woman dance is a sight to behold. Her movements are fluid and elegant, capturing the essence of her beauty.

The women of Rajasthan also have a strong sense of community. They often gather together for festivals and celebrations. During these times, they dress in their finest clothes and jewelry. They sing, dance, and celebrate together. This sense of community and togetherness adds to their charm.
